Middle School Campus Director Of Special EducationTwo Rivers Public Charter School Aug 2021 - Dec 2021Washington, District Of Columbia, UsExecuted Two Rivers' vision for special education at the campus level. Served on school leadership teams and share in the duties of running the special education program. Facilitated IEP, 504, and multidisciplinary team meetings. Assisted in the planning and facilitation of high-quality professional development for special education teachers, including, IEP development, data analysis, and inclusive instructional strategies. Supervised related service providers and dedicated aides to ensure that students have high-quality experiences. Provided hands-on coaching to a portfolio of teachers on the effective implementation of instructional strategies for achieving IEP goals as assigned by the principal. Provided feedback to special education teachers to ensure IEPs are designed to best support student growth. Facilitated data-based discussions to ensure 100% of students are making progress on IEP goals.Served as the school-level face of the special education team for the campus. Ensured IEPs were compliant with federal and district regulations, goals were standards-based and relevant for the individual student, and present levels of performance were appropriate and current. Ensured all staff abide by IDEA and local regulations. Provide assistance to staff members in order to comply with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) and Section 504. -
